  • Q: How to replace the Rocker Shaft Spring Kit and valve stem oil seal on Chevrolet Blazer?
    A: The Valve Stem Oil Seal and valve spring replacement process starts by taking off the valve Rocker Arm cover and then continuing to remove appropriate valve rocker arms and spark plugs. Attach the j 22794 (Spark Plug Port Adapter) to your Spark Plug hole, run a shop air supply hose, and blow compressed air to immobilize the valves. Start by removing the valve Rocker Arm bolt then place a flat washer onto it and reinstall the valve Rocker Arm bolt into the spring's operating hole. Handle valve spring compressors carefully because compressed valve springs generate significant spring tension. Operate the j 5892-d (Valve Spring Compressor) by slipping its slotted end under the washer on the valve Rocker Arm bolt then apply continuous pressure to access the valve keys. Use the j 38606 (Valve Spring Compressor) if complete valve spring engagement cannot be achieved. Use the existing tools to remove the valve keys then carefully let go of valve spring tension before removing either the j 5892-d or j 38606. Begin by first removing the valve spring cap then the valve spring and finally the Valve Stem Oil Seal. First select the correct Valve Stem Oil Seal then coat both the valve guide and stem with clean engine oil before placing the seal onto the stem. Use the j 42073 (Valve Stem Seal Installer) to position the Valve Stem Oil Seal on the valve guide with a 1 - 2 mm distance between the seal and the guide. Position the valve spring and valve spring cap followed by another compression step using the j 5892-d or j 38606 valve spring compressor tool. Insert the valve stem o-ring seal with valve stem keys and keep the keys in place by applying grease. Slowly release valve spring pressure until the keys stay in position correctly. The j 5892-d and j 38606 should be removed at this point. Conclude the process by checking the valve stem key seating. When necessary tap the stem and remove the j 22794. Then fully install the spark plugs along with valve rocker arms and valve Rocker Arm cover.
